Missing Service Dog Rolo Found Safe After Essex Police Appeal

Springer Spaniel Vanishes in Stansted

Rolo, a springer spaniel and trained service dog, went missing around 6pm on Tuesday near Bury Lodge Lane, Stansted. The local community was soon on high alert.

Massive Public Response Aids Police Search

Essex Police teamed up with Border Force officers and took to Facebook, sharing Rolo’s photo to rally help. Hundreds of locals flooded the post with comments, and it was shared over 6,000 times.

Authorities even explored using a drone with Stansted Airport officials to track down the elusive dog.

Happy Ending for Rolo and Owner

On Wednesday evening, police revealed a heartwarming update. After multiple public sightings, Rolo was found safe and is now reunited with his owner.

Officers hailed the outcome as “very happy” and thanked the community for their invaluable support.
